Chevrolet Camaro Cabriolet - real or photoshop?

The Chevrolet Camaro is preparing for its launch and has been caught undergoing testing multiple times now. Sometimes in black, sometimes in white and sometimes without camouflage, but not yet as a cabriolet.

There is no doubt that the Camaro will eventually be available as a convertible, after all it has been shown in concept form already. Camaro5 forum came across these images of a supposed Camaro Cabrio, and we hope that they are real, but looking closer at the two images will reveal a few details which just are not right.

For one, if the photos were made during a photo shoot of some kind, wouldn't the car have the same wheels? The front shot shows the Camaro sitting on wheels we have seen before on the coupe prototypes but the side-view car sits on differing rims. Secondly, there is no rear-view mirror, gas-cap, front turn signals or reverse lights. To top it off, the headlight halos don't really seem to fit the front fascia.
